### sec.204A Alternative calculation of rent for resource authorities
A regulation may provide for the Minister to apply an alternative way of calculating the rent payable for a resource authority, so that a lesser amount of rent is payable, in the circumstances prescribed by regulation.
Subsection (3) applies if, under a regulation made under subsection (1) —
the Minister applies an alternative way of calculating the rent payable for a resource authority for a particular period; and
the calculated amount is less than the amount of rent that would otherwise be payable for the period under the relevant Resource Act for the authority or a condition of the authority.
Despite the relevant Resource Act for the resource authority or a condition of the authority, the rental payable for the authority for the period is the lesser amount.
s 204A ins 2024 No. 33 s 89
